So what are y'all's thoughts on the Pimax 5K XR vs the HP Reverb vs the Valve Index? Here's what I've garnered so far: Pimax 5K XR Glorious FOV (170° horizontal!) PPD 12-21ish per wikipedia (assuming the range is horizontal vs vertical?) [*]2x2560x1440 OLED displays (gotta love dynamic contrast ratio) [*]Headphones+microphone [*]$900 Also needs steam base station? (necessary for tracking?) Valve Index Beautiful FOV (130° FOV) PPD 11 [*]2x1440x1600 LCD displays ("ultra-low persistence global backlight illumination" FWIW) [*]Headphones+microphone [*]$500 for headset +$149 for base station (necessary for tracking?) HP Reverb FOV 114° (is this good enough?) PPD 19 [*]2x2160x2160 LCD displays No IPD adjustment!? Is this a deal-breaker? [*]Microphone+removable headphones [*]$650 No base station!   13. If you're talking about the EEG for the good engine, be very careful that you don't burn out your one good engine. Also, this step is not in the emergency procedures for single engine failure during flight or during hover. Also also, don't forget to open up the fuel crossfeed valve. That will allow the single functioning engine to draw fuel from both the fore and aft tanks, hopefully avoiding a dangerous weight imbalance. The manual has a whole chapter (ch. 12) of checklists. Engine failure checklists start on ch. 12 p. 23 (aka p. 443).
